For more information about Stanford’s graduate programs, visit: https://online.stanford.edu/graduate-education November 21, 2025 This seminar examines the critical barriers that continue to limit progress toward general-purpose robotic manipulation and discusses the catalyst problems that currently prevent robots from operating effectively at scale in domestic, industrial, and agricultural settings.
